			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>OK a bit more advanced and fiddly involving all manner of small rubber objects ( so definitley Euro ) is the Helicopter Rig. So called because the leader is attached to a swivel on the mainline causing the leader to rotate about the line on casting like helicopter blades.</p>
<p>  Why bother? Well it&#8217;s a good long range, anti-tangle set up. Again I&#8217;m not going to debate the merits and variations ( as usual there are slightly different ways to skin this cat ), rather illustrate how it&#8217;s tied and leave the debate for another time.</p>
<p>This rig can be bought in ready to assemble kits and I would recommend these as they&#8217;re usualy safer. However I don&#8217;t think its so bizarre and specialised that it can&#8217;t be made without the custom made components either. </p>
<p>The kit I&#8217;m using here is by Korda. Here are the components.</p>
<p> <img src="http://www.carpanglersgroup.com/helicopterrigcomponents.jpg" alt="" width="431" height="317" /></p>
<p>1. Rig tubing<br />
  2. Lead weight<br />
  3. Buffer bead<br />
  4. Rubber bead<br />
  5. Swivel bead ( a wide bore swivel will do the job as well )<br />
  6. Tail rubber<br />
  7. Leader ( stiff leaders work best &#8211; I&#8217;ve used coated braid here ) Apologies &#8211; the leader shouldn&#8217;t have a swivel on it  </p>
<p><strong>Step 1</strong></p>
<p>  <img src="http://www.carpanglersgroup.com/hr1sodbury.jpg" alt="" width="403" height="214" /> </p>
<p>Thread your mainline through the tubing and push a tight fitting rubber bead over the tubing.  </p>
<p><strong>Step 2 </strong></p>
<p><img src="http://www.carpanglersgroup.com/hr2sodbury.jpg" alt="" width="360" height="131" /> </p>
<p>Thread the tail rubber onto your leader and tie the leader to the swivel bead.  </p>
<p><strong>Step 3 </strong></p>
<p><img src="http://www.carpanglersgroup.com/hr3sodbury.jpg" alt="" width="433" height="449" /> </p>
<p>Push the tail rubber onto the swivel bead and slide the swivel bead onto the tubing. Then thread your buffer bead onto the tubing.  </p>
<p><strong>Step 4</strong></p>
<p> <img src="http://www.carpanglersgroup.com/hr4sodbury.jpg" alt="" width="403" height="312" /> </p>
<p>Tie the lead weight to the mainline and slide everything nice and tightly together. Job done <img src='http://carpersweb.com/wp-includes/images/smilies/icon_smile.gif' alt=':)' class='wp-smiley' /> </p>
